The left upper quadrant is the location of the left portion of the liver, the larger portion of the stomach, the pancreas, left kidney, spleen, portions of the transverse and descending colon, and parts of the small intestine.

Spleen is located in the left upper quadrant. ( This quadrant is more of a triangle!) Spleen is located of deep inside. Rather on the backside of the abdomen in that region. It has to become double in size before it can just be palpated per abdomen.

The spleen is located in the Left Hypochondriac region.
